What and where does this go? - (driver's window)

My driver's side window stuck in the halfway position. While activating the switch up or down the window would move a few inches while making a grinding noise as if something was rubbing against a cable(?).
When I pulled the door panel off to investigate - I could not see, feel or find anything wrong.
Oddly enough the window then began functioning normal up/down, no noise, or seizing
I decided to pull the lower speaker for a better view and found this stuck to the magnet of the speaker...



I could not find anything related on realOEM.
Anyone know where this odd looking piece may have come from?

Think I may have figured it out. Door brake, part number 51217176811. Has a medal disc on either side. Check out the shape of those discs...
